Movement to the target point
Movement control to the given point
Move to button starts the process of moving to the given position.
Shift on button starts the process of shift to a given distance from the target position.
Target position for motion commands
Commands Move to and Shift on use the target position to calculate the movement. The target position is changed by the following
commands:
Move to <value>
Target position = <value>
Shift on <offset>
Target position = target position + <offset>
Zero (provided there is no movement at the moment of sending the command)
Target position = 0
Commands Stop, Left, Right, Left up to the border and Right up to the border do not alter the target position.
Attenuator Control Unit
Attenuator Control Unit
At the top of the attenuator control block a Transmittance window and a Calibrate button are located. Transmittance window contains a
control to select desired transmittance coefficient. Calibrate button does manual calibration, or location of the initial position, of the
attenuator - first it initiates one revolution of attenuator with current controller settings to determine relative position of attenuator
wheels and then does Automatic Home position calibration . Calibrate button is optional - if the attenuator did not perform the
calibration or it was reset, for example by pressing Cancel during movement, calibration will be performed before the next movement
automatically.
Attenuator has one or two wheels, each wheel contains 8 optical filters. Below these filters are visualized as bars with circles. Below a
Current Transmittance window is located. This window contains trasmittance coefficient which is the closest to desired one that can be
achieved with the current filters.
Move button performs movement toward the filters corresponding to the Current Transmittance, that is, the highlighted ones.
Reset button deactivates all filters.
